    The Ultimo4k will definitely run IPTV but it will not take the iptv streams you are currently getting via your ISP and Youview box. You will need to use a different 3rd party provider. The provider should have some sort of tutorial on how to run their services on various device types.

    Have a search for Suls e2m3u2bouquet
